预处理器时代的CSS性能
2013-08-21 09:30
CSS是一个简单的表述编程语言。预处理器的引入突破了很多局限性,补充了急需的语言特性比如继承、混入、变量以及helper。开发人员对这些功能望穿秋水,现在象SASS、Less和Stylus这样的CSS预处理器框架在大型网站上已经无处不在了。当然预处理器带来性能提高的同时往往给出很多丑八怪代码。本话题中你将了解到一组新的采用CSS预处理器的性能最佳实践,以及CSS预处理器五大性能问题。
Nicole Sullivan
Stubbornella
Nicole是一名前端性能顾问、CSS狂热分子。她开创的面向对象CSS开源项目解决了百万级访问的网站扩展CSS的问题。Nicole的客户包括Facebook、Saleforce、W3C、Adobe、Paypal、Trulia以及Box。她参与创建的服务包括Smush.it(云图片优化服务,CSS Lint(CSS验证工具)。Nicole热衷于CSS、Web标准,大型商业网站前端可扩展架构。她还是“The Web Performance Daybook, Vol 2”作者之一,“Even Faster Websites“作者之一,她的博客在stubbornella.org。